My website has suddenly reverted to a version over a year old. I can no longer log in to the wordpress backend.

I called our host (godaddy) and they restored to the version three days ago (when the website was fine), and it is still the extremely old website. They haven't been helpful beyond that in finding the issue. What is happening? Any advice appreciated. When I try to log in to the wordpress backend, I get "Error: There is no account with that username or email address." Thank you

  1. Try renaming your plugins folder and try logging in again.

    If it is still an issue, get them to restore another day or two before.

    Likely the “fine” version you saw was actually cached.
